The counterbalanced forklift is a lift truck which utilizes a counter balance that is connected to the back end of the equipment. This counterbalance effectively balances loads which are positioned on the blades at the front end of the machine. This particular design is engineered to stabilize typical forklifts. When it comes to electric counterbalance lift trucks, the counterweight is formed by the battery itself.
Counterbalance lift trucks could often be found in every manufacturer's product range. They are typically manufactured in a variety of sizes and configurations, utilizing a range of fuel sources. These forklifts could with solid or pneumatic tires, and be designed with 4 or 3 wheels. They could work in various applications. These kinds of lift trucks are equipped with a range of accessories. Common attachments and options include: hydraulic clamps, side shifts, fork shifts and slip sheet attachments just to mention a few.

These equipment are important to the shipping and receiving centers all over the world as they are utilized for stacking, loading, horizontal transport functions and unloading. The standard warehouse forklifts are normally utilized for lift heights under 6 meters or 20 feet. There have been some units recently developed which could lift to heights 31 feet or 9.5 meters. The smaller 1-1.8 ton or 4000 lbs. forklifts are the main workhorses within most warehouses. These are the most common units which most small businesses would own. The average warehouse counterbalance forklift is actually a wide-aisle truck which needs approximately 11 feet or 3 meters to turn in.
Counterbalance forklifts are not necessarily limited to the warehouse. They are normally utilized for carrying containers and heavy use along with pretty much every use in between. Counterbalance forklifts are the most widely used and versatile of all materials handling machinery.
The counterbalanced forklift is common in numerous working environments, like production, retail and warehousing. This is because of their durability and versatility. Some of the industrial applications include: food, chemical, automotive and timber industries.
